Output facf378f53187e11cfa90689afafb78179a866d85429ed4ec95a955947dd594f:0

value
572757583
script pubkey
OP_0 OP_PUSHBYTES_20 d681e368fd12b7c7072818108797a463dca4c2fa
address
bc1q66q7x68az2muwpegrqgg09ayv0w2fsh6w5arsw
transaction
facf378f53187e11cfa90689afafb78179a866d85429ed4ec95a955947dd594f